Research Abstract

Test of the quantum chromodynamics (QCD) is important in order to discover and phenomena beyond the standard model of elementary particle physics. Although QCD is known to hold pretty well at high energies, test of QCD at low energies is not easy since calculation has to be carried out without using perturbative method due to the large coupling constant in Lagrangian. We have planned an experiment, called DIRAC, of measuring the decay lifetime of πィイD1+ィエD1πィイD1-ィエD1 atoms to πィイD10ィエD1πィイD10ィエD1 at CERN PS to test the predictions of CHPT, the effective theory of QCD at low energies, to an accuracy of 5%, and started data-taking in 1999. In this experiment, it is important to detect precisely two minimum-ionising particles at short distances (<5-6 mm) within 100 ns after the occurrence of the event. We developed necessary fast Scifi and dE/dx detectors for position and dE/dx measurements, respectively. While we detect πィイD1+ィエD1πィイD1-ィエD1 pairs coming from dissociation of πィイD1+ィエD1πィイD1-ィエD1 atoms in DIRAC, direct detection of decay πィイD10ィエD1πィイD10ィエD1 should have a merit for improved experiment in future. So, we also carried out R&D for fast, heavy and radiation-hard scintillators for excellent g-ray detectors.
1. Scifi-detectors and fast triggering electronics were successfully constructed and are now in use.
2. We have succeeded in developing (1) Si-detectors (64x64mmィイD12ィエD1 in size, 300μm thick and read-out at a step of 1-2mm), (2) charge preamplifier with decay time of 100-240 ns and ENC of 3000e, and (3) shaping amplifier of gain 50 and pulse width of 50 ns. This will replace the present dE/dx detectors of plastic-scintillato strips from 2001.
We have made significant improvement in heavy, fas and radiation hard scintillators such as PbWOィイD24ィエD2, GdィイD22ィエD2SiOィイD25ィエD2:Ce, etc.
